Public meetings to discuss possible police merger
Aug 9, 2010 8:59:00 PM - thestate.com
Columbia City Council members have scheduled four public meetings throughout the citys four council districts to discuss the possibility of Richland County Sheriff Leon Lott managing the Columbia Police Department.
The meetings are:
District 1: Aug. 24, 6:30 p.m. at the Eau Claire Print Building, 3907 Ensor Avenue. The meeting is in conjunction with the Eau Claire Community Councils quarterly meeting.
District 2: Aug. 31, 6 p.m. at the Cecil Tillis Center, 2111 Simpkins Lane.
District 3: Aug. 25, 5:30 p.m. at the Capital Senior Center, 1650 Park Circle. Lott is scheduled to attend the meeting
